About Carleton

Carleton is a quaint village located on the southern edge of Pontefract within the Wakefield district of West Yorkshire, England. The village features the parish church of St Michael the Archangel, along with two educational institutions: Carleton High School and Rookeries Primary School. Additionally, Pontefract RUFC is situated in the village, contributing to the local community's sporting activities.

Planning Activity in Carleton

In the last 24 months, 16 planning applications were submitted near Carleton. Of these, 80% were approved, with an average decision time of 41 days.

This is below the national average of approximately 87%, which may reflect stricter local policies, sensitivity of the area, or higher levels of speculative applications. Pre-application advice is particularly worthwhile near Carleton.

The average decision time of 41 days is within the government's 8-week statutory target for minor applications, indicating an efficient planning department.

The most common application types near Carleton were discharge of conditions (4), outline applications (3), full planning applications (2).

10 planning appeals were lodged, of which 2 were allowed and 8 were dismissed (20% success rate). This low success rate indicates that the council's refusal decisions are generally upheld by the Planning Inspectorate.
